  • If you want BScreen 'Sync_to_Retrace' capability make sure you enabled 'assign IRQ to VGA card' in your system BIOS (if available);
  • If the driver still seems to create 'random' trouble make sure you have a fully functional VGA BIOS, or system BIOS for embedded cards (check for updates on the manufacturor's site). Make sure you mail me if you still have trouble but also if this version fixed that!
  • If on a laptop the internal panel doesn't work when you connect an external monitor, make sure you set 'output device selection' to 'internal' (instead of 'auto') in the system BIOS if it has such an option. If you have this symptom on a normal card, or on a laptop without that BIOS option then you are probably out of luck for dualhead support; -

  • NV40 architecture cards: (GeForce 6xxx, but 6800 AGP seems to be OK)
    Secondary analog monitor detection doesn't work and we can't control very well to which connector the card's output gets routed (lack of specs). This means you might have to experiment a bit with the way you connect your monitor to the card. A single analog or DVI screen should work OK, and two analog screens should be OK as well.
